Contribution Rates The Speediest Way to Earn
You won't accumulate points at the same speed on all games. Knowing this helps if you want to maximise your haul. Slots typically provide you with 100% of your wager counted towards points, making them the fastest track. Table games and video poker commonly offer less, around 20% to 25%. Be sure to check the fine print, as games like blackjack or roulette can have their own rules. Live dealer games normally adhere to the same reduced rate as other tables. This arrangement is common, but it undoubtedly encourages slot play. For you, it means your choice of game straight affects how quickly rewards grow.
The Actual Influence on Your Bankroll
How does this loyalty scheme truly impact your money? The bonus credits you earn from points serve as a small, consistent rebate. Over a long period, this reduces slightly the house edge, offering your bankroll a little more cushion. It's not a magic profit button. It's a way to stretch your playtime and lessen the impact of a losing streak. If you're disciplined, cashing in points for bonus credit can help you through a rough patch. There's a psychological side too. Earning points offers you a second stream of positive feedback, separate from winning or losing a bet, which can keep the whole experience more engaging.
